Interior Light wont illuminate as I open the door
 
I have a '02 "S"... when I open the door the interior light won't come on? When I put the key in and turn the light will come on and then dim (normal). Any sensors I can check?
Wiring? Any clues would be helpful.

any other odd gremlins like...

key hard to pull out/turn?

ignition doesn't "clunk" when removing key?

radio stays stuck on after key removed?

If so, might be the usual electrical gremlin culprit.... bad ignition switch.

What do you mean interior light? All the lights (doors etc) or just the top light?

If it just the top light then my best bet is that your connections aren't right in there.
There are three positions in the top light (on, off, and dependent to doors opening). The technology in the top light is bull, just two metal connectors that are in contact. Mine was loose and when I changed the lump I tightened it a bit.

If you are lucky, it might be just that. You need to "align" the connection inside the light assembly.

+1 what burg boxster is alluding to, the infamous "ignition switch" failure. Mine went out and was pretty easy to replace. That little thing can really wreak havoc with your electrics.
have you replaced yours yet? check the DIY thread on here. It covers it pretty well and references pedros site. Only about a $30 part and fairly easy to install(with small hands).

The porsche dealer fixed mine, it was in "transport mode" had to do a "vehicle handover" this fixed the problem
